PRIMARY WAVE’S TALENT MANAGEMENT DIVISION MERGES WITH INTELLECTUAL ARTISTS MANAGEMENT

January 19th, 2015

PRIMARY WAVE’S TALENT MANAGEMENT DIVISION MERGES WITH INTELLECTUAL ARTISTS MANAGEMENT

Creating a Full Service Entertainment Management Powerhouse for Creative Talent Across All Industries from Music and Film to TV and Literary
 
The Combined Management Roster will Now Include Golden Globe winner Gina Rodriguez, Oscar winner Bobby Moresco, Grammy Award winners CeeLo Green, Melissa Etheridge, Cypress Hill, Eric Benet, along with William Fichtner, Mayim Bialik, Peter Facinelli, Gabrielle Union, AJ Cook, Natalie Imbruglia, Oni Press, and more
 
New York, N.Y. (January 19, 2015) — Primary Wave, one of the largest independent music marketing, talent management and music publishing companies in the US, confirms the merger of Primary Wave’s Talent Management divisions with Intellectual Artists Management, a full-service talent and literary management, media and content production company.  By uniting Primary Wave’s expertise in music, digital, and branding with Intellectual’s strong hold on the film/TV industry, this newly formed talent management team will provide full access and opportunities for their roster across multiple platforms from music and film to TV and literary. The new powerhouse talent management company will work under the new name Primary Wave Entertainment and will be run by co-CEOs and industry leaders Larry Mestel, CEO/Founder of Primary Wave Music, David Guillod, CEO/Founder of Intellectual, and Mark Burg, CEO/Founder of Evolution, who will serve as Vice Chairman.
 
“Jeff, Patrick and I are very excited to partner with Larry and his team, which will perfectly position us to become a global entertainment, media, branding and licensing powerhouse. I look forward to our new relationship and our continued aggressive growth in the future,” states David Guillod.
 
In addition to the new name, Primary Wave Entertainment will combine its staff under one roof with New York and LA offices and will also refer to their two existing rosters as one. Intellectual’s roster consists of Oscar winning writer/directors Jim Rash (Descendants), Mike Radford (Il Postino) and Bobby Moresco (Crash) as well as, Golden Globe winner Gina Rodriquez (Jane the Virgin), David Arquette, Gabrielle Union, AJ Cook, Nia Long, William Fichtner, Donald Faison, Manu Bennett, Cole Hauser, and Peter Facinelli. Primary Wave’s current roster includes CeeLo Green, Melissa Etheridge, Cypress Hill, Eric Benét, Natalie Imbruglia, The Go-Go’s, Trevor Jackson, Ginuwine, Goodie Mob, Cris Cab, Big Gipp, producer/DJ Audien, actress Jane Lynch, among others. As part of the merger, this new, diverse roster consisting of recording artists, film/TV stars and writer/directors, will now all have access to Primary Wave’s in-house resources such as their Branding company, Digital Marketing division, and Sync team. Known as leaders in providing brand and digital strategies for their talent, Primary Wave and Intellectual also have combined direct brand alliances with Klipsch, VOX, Sprint, NIVEA, Tommy Hilfiger, Times Square Alliance, among many others.
 
“I’m proud to be entering into this partnership with David and his amazing team at Intellectual,” explains Larry Mestel, CEO of Primary Wave. “This is truly, an exciting business step for both companies and will give our roster of artists the opportunity to expand their brands across many platforms within the entertainment industry.”
 
With both company’s successfully making an impact in their respective industries, this new venture is a natural, complementing match and expansion for both teams. The announcement also follows the recent news that Primary Wave acquired the film/TV talent management and production company Evolution Entertainment Partners run by Mark Burg, which has produced over 40 films including Can’t Buy Me Love, The Sandlot, John Q and the entire SAW franchise as well as executive produced the TV series Two And A Half Men and 100 episodes of Anger Management. This acquisition will also fall under the new Primary Wave / Intellectual merger.  In addition to talent management, the new Primary Wave Entertainment team will continue to produce, develop and finance new film and TV projects. Since expanding into the TV business in 2013, Primary Wave has overseen a development and production slate of over a dozen original projects in both the scripted and unscripted world and has placed three shows on air including TBS’ The Good Life and also extended the CeeLo Green brand into the film world, securing roles in Sparkle, Hotel Transylvania, and Begin Again.
